Sweep Away Product Oil Stain Removal Process
Sweep Away Products

Dealing with stubborn oil stains on your concrete surfaces can be a real challenge. But worry no more! Introducing the Sweep Away Products Oil Stain Removal Process. This three-step process will make removing oil stains a breeze. In this blog post, we will walk you through each step and help you understand how these products work together to give your concrete surfaces a fresh, clean look.



Oil Stain Degreaser for motor oil stains on concrete

Start by generously applying the Sweep Away Spray Oil Stain Degreaser to the affected area. This powerful degreaser breaks down the oil molecules, making it easier for the subsequent products to remove the stain.


Oil Stain Absorber to soak up and remove oil stain spills on concrete, pavers and asphalt

Next, sprinkle the Sweep Away Oil Stain Absorber onto the stained area, ensuring even coverage. The absorber works by lifting and trapping the oil particles, allowing for easy removal.


All natural oil stain remover bio enzymes


Step 3: Finish with Sweep Away Oil Stain Eliminator

Finally, apply the Sweep Away Oil Stain Eliminator to the treated area. This product penetrates deep into the concrete, removing any residual oil and preventing future staining. Remember not to rinse it off, as the longer it remains on the surface, the better the results.
